Steven Mark Platau is a adr attorney based in Tampa, Florida. They have 42+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1984. Admitted to practice in Florida (1984), District of Columbia (1985), U.S. District Court, Middle District of Florida (1985), and U.S. Tax Court (1986). Educated at University of Cincinnati (J.D., 1984) and Ohio State University (B.A. Ohio, 1978). Serands clients in Tampa, FL and the surrounding metropolitan area.
